Why AI matters at this scale

Central Consolidated School District is a public K-12 school district serving a large, predominantly Navajo student population across a rural region of New Mexico. With 501-1000 employees, it operates multiple schools, managing complex logistics, diverse student needs, and stringent state/federal reporting requirements on a constrained public budget. The district's mission is to provide equitable, high-quality education in a challenging geographic and socioeconomic context.

For a mid-sized public district, AI is not about futuristic replacement but pragmatic augmentation. At this scale, administrative burdens are high, per-student resources are often stretched, and achieving personalized learning for hundreds of students is a monumental task for teaching staff. AI offers tools to automate time-consuming processes, derive insights from student data to target support, and provide scalable, individualized learning pathways—directly addressing core challenges of efficiency, equity, and effectiveness within public education's fiscal realities.

Concrete AI Opportunities with ROI Framing

1. Adaptive Learning Platforms: Deploying AI-driven software that adjusts content difficulty and style in real-time based on student responses can directly address learning gaps. ROI comes from potentially improved standardized test scores (tying to funding), reduced need for costly remedial summer programs, and more efficient use of teacher time, allowing them to focus on high-touch instruction. 2. Predictive Analytics for Student Retention: Machine learning models analyzing attendance, grades, and engagement can flag students at risk of dropping out or chronic absenteeism years earlier than traditional methods. The ROI is profound: preventing a single dropout can save the district over $100,000 in long-term social costs and secure future per-pupil state funding. Early intervention is far cheaper than recovery. 3. Intelligent Administrative Automation: AI can automate the compilation of data for critical reports like those for the Individuals with Disabilities Education Act (IDEA) or state accountability systems. This reduces hundreds of staff hours spent on manual data aggregation, minimizing errors and freeing up personnel for student-facing services. The ROI is direct labor cost savings and reduced compliance risk.

Deployment Risks Specific to a 500-1000 Employee Public Sector Entity

Implementation risks are significant. First, data governance and privacy are paramount; a breach of student records (protected under FERPA) would be catastrophic. Any AI system must be vetted for compliance and security. Second, change management across multiple school sites with varying tech proficiency requires extensive training and buy-in from teachers and administrators, not just IT. Third, funding and sustainability pose a major hurdle. AI tools often require subscription costs and dedicated support. A mid-sized district cannot rely on pilot grants alone; any investment must show a clear path to being baked into the operational budget. Finally, infrastructure and equity must be considered—ensuring all students, including those without reliable home internet, can benefit from AI-enhanced tools to avoid widening the digital divide.

Frequently asked

Common questions about AI for k-12 public education

How can AI help with teacher shortages?
AI can act as a teaching assistant, automating grading, creating lesson materials, and providing student data dashboards, allowing teachers to focus more on direct instruction and relationships.
What are the biggest risks for AI in a school district?
Key risks include student data privacy (FERPA compliance), algorithmic bias reinforcing inequities, high initial costs, and ensuring technology complements rather than replaces human educators.
Is our IT infrastructure ready for AI?
Likely not without investment. AI requires robust data integration, cloud storage, and device access. A phased pilot program starting with cloud-based SaaS tools is most feasible.
Can AI support Navajo language and culture?
Yes, potentially. AI could aid in developing digital Navajo language resources, transcribing elder stories, or creating culturally relevant educational content, but must be developed with deep community partnership.
